The Core Calculation: Years, Months, and Days
Calculating age isn't as simple as subtracting the birth year from the current year. To get an accurate result in years, months, and days, we have to account for the specific dates. The process is similar to how you "borrow" in manual subtraction.
- Subtract the Days: If the current day is less than the birth day, we "borrow" the number of days from the previous month and add it to the current day before subtracting.
- Subtract the Months: After adjusting the days, we subtract the birth month from the current month. If the current month is now less than the birth month, we "borrow" 12 months from the year.
- Subtract the Years: Finally, we subtract the birth year from the (potentially adjusted) current year.
This method, which our Age Calculator performs instantly, ensures a precise result that accounts for the varying lengths of months and the occurrence of leap years.

Fun with Astronomy: Your Age on Other Planets
A "year" is defined by how long it takes a planet to orbit the Sun. Since each planet has a different orbital period, your age would be different if you lived on another world! Our Age Calculator includes this fun feature by taking your age in Earth days and dividing it by the length of a year on other planets:
- Mercury: With a year of only 88 Earth days, you'd be much "older" on Mercury.
- Mars: A Martian year is about 687 Earth days, so your age in Mars years would be roughly half your Earth age.
- Jupiter: It takes Jupiter almost 12 Earth years to orbit the Sun. If you're 30 on Earth, you wouldn't have even celebrated your 3rd birthday on Jupiter!
